Information for faculty and staff
Parking
The Department of Public Safety has arranged for faculty and staff parking that should accommodate everyone.

- Graduates, faculty and staff participating in the ceremony are encouraged to arrive early.
- Reserved parking for faculty and staff is on a first-come, first-served basis. Parking lots that are not full by 11 a.m. will be opened for general parking.
- Medstar Franklin Square Hospital Center is the preferred lot for faculty and staff parking. Much of the hospital parking is closer to the Wellness and Athletics Center. It’s also an easier departure location following the ceremony.
- Faculty and staff who wish to park on CCBC Essex parking lots should enter at the main campus entrance on Rossville Boulevard and remain in the right lane. Turn right onto Division Lane and then turn right onto Alpha Bay. Continue straight, crossing South Lane and continuing on College Drive South. Vehicles displaying a current faculty or staff parking permit will be directed to Lot 2.
- Free parking is available throughout the campus. Lots closest to the Commencement ceremony venue are:
- Lot 2 — Faculty and staff, special guests, accessible overflow parking
- Lot 3 — Accessible parking
- Lot 4 — VIP and open/general parking
- Lots 1, 5, 6 and 7 — Open/general parking
- Individuals with limited mobility and requiring assistance will be directed to designated parking upon arrival at the main entrance to the campus.
- Accessible and senior citizen parking is located in Lot 3. Public Safety officers will be accommodating in evaluating parking requests when accessible permits are not displayed, as in the case of an elderly or infirm passenger who cannot walk a long distance. Such persons may also be dropped off at the Dome Spur (Wellness and Athletics Center) before the vehicle is parked.
- After the ceremony, exit the campus at the direction of CCBC Public Safety personnel.
Regalia
CCBC faculty and staff regalia must be ordered prior to May 6. Orders placed on or after May 6 are not guaranteed to arrive on time for the ceremony and will be assessed a $30 late fee in addition to the cost of the cap and gown. The first day to pick up Commencement regalia at campus bookstores is Monday, May 1. A CCBC bookstore manager will contact the faculty when the regalia arrives.

Robing and processional
Participants should be robed and ready to process no later than 12:45 p.m.
The processional will begin promptly at 1:20 p.m. Faculty and staff will process ahead of the student graduates.

Weather concerns
Prior to and during commencement, members of CCBC Public Safety and Plant Operations will be evaluating weather conditions that might affect the event. Light rain or drizzle will not be a factor, but high winds or lightning may cause changes to the ceremony schedule.
As a faculty or staff member, your help in directing guests to safe areas is greatly appreciated.
The decision to continue the event will be made as soon as conditions allow. CCBC Public Safety officers and event staff will announce updated information by moving through the buildings and parking lots.
In the event severe weather or other circumstances require a tent evacuation, the ceremony emcee will ask that people move promptly to their cars, or to the Wellness and Athletics Center, the Romadka College Center, or the Arts and Humanities Hall. CCBC Public Safety officers on duty will assist in guiding guests to those locations. Cars are the preferred destination, as building capacities are limited.
